Historical Background of the Area
Shatti Al Hamriya is not just a newly developed tourist hotspot; it has a history that reflects the larger narrative of Dubai. Once a tranquil fishing village, this area gradually transitioned into a thriving community as infrastructure improved and the city expanded. Locals recall times when the coastal waters teemed with fish, and the air was filled with the salty breezes that shaped the livelihoods of the families living in the region.
As Dubai grew into the vibrant metropolis it is today, Shatti Al Hamriya transformed alongside it. While modernization brought skyscrapers and luxurious accommodations, the area manages to retain its connection to the past. Traditional dhow boats can still be seen bobbing on the water, serving as a reminder of the local maritime heritage. Little snippets of history can be seen in the architecture and layout of some buildings, hinting at the area's roots amidst an ever-evolving skyline.

Regulatory Environment for Investors
Diving into investment without a firm grasp of the regulatory environment can spell trouble. The laws governing real estate in Dubai are somewhat labyrinthine and can differ markedly from other places across the globe. This presents both challenges and opportunities.
- Ownership Laws: For instance, Shatti Al Hamriya features freehold zones, allowing foreigners a stake in properties, yet conditions may change, influencing stability in ownership.
- Permitting Process: It's important to know the approval processes for new developments or renovations. Delays or changes in regulations can set back investment timelines.
"Investing without understanding the regulatory framework is like sailing a ship without a map; you're bound to get lost."
Keep in mind that regulations might evolve in response to economic changes or governmental policies. Investors should familiarize themselves with the latest rules and engage with legal experts where necessary.
